aerobic vs. anaerobic
[ai-roh-, uh-roh-bik]
/ ɛəˈroʊ-, əˈroʊ bɪk /
adjective
-
(of an organism or tissue) requiring the presence of air or free oxygen for life.
-
pertaining to or caused by the presence of oxygen.
-
of or utilizing the principles of aerobics.
aerobic exercises;
aerobic dances.
[an-uh-roh-bik, an-ai-]
/ ˌæn əˈroʊ bɪk, ˌæn ɛə- /
adjective
-
(of an organism or tissue) living in the absence of air or free oxygen.
-
pertaining to or caused by the absence of oxygen.
